### CR-01: `getEventsForEmbed` / `getAllEventsForEmbed` bypass `enabled` filter when `calendarNames` is provided
|
||||
|
||||
**File:** `src/services/CalendarService.ts:140-161`, `src/services/CalendarService.ts:168-189`
|
||||
|
||||
**Issue:** When a `memochron-agenda` or `memochron-calendar` code block names calendars explicitly via the `calendars:` parameter, the filtering logic walks only the case-insensitive name match:
|
||||
|
||||
```ts
|
||||
if (calendarNames && calendarNames.length > 0) {
|
||||
const lowerNames = calendarNames.map((n) => n.toLowerCase());
|
||||
filteredEvents = filteredEvents.filter((event) =>
|
||||
lowerNames.includes(event.source.toLowerCase())
|
||||
);
|
||||
}
|
||||
```
|
||||
|
||||
The `else` branch correctly filters by `source.enabled && source.showInEmbeds !== false`, but the `calendarNames` branch does NOT consult `source.enabled` at all. Events from a calendar that the user has explicitly DISABLED in settings still render in any embed that names that calendar.
|
||||
|
||||
This breaks the documented invariant ("Disable a calendar to stop fetching/showing its events") and is a privacy regression — a user who disables a sensitive work calendar to hide it on a shared screen will still see its events in an embedded code block. Note that `this.events` may still contain the disabled calendar's events from the last fetch before disabling (cache-write doesn't purge events when a source flips off; see CalendarService.performFetch which only re-fetches from `enabledSources`, but `hasSourceMismatch` lazily re-fetches on the next call — until then, stale events remain).
|
||||
|
||||
**Fix:** Intersect both filters in the `calendarNames` branch:
|
||||
|
||||
```ts
|
||||
if (calendarNames && calendarNames.length > 0) {
|
||||
const lowerNames = calendarNames.map((n) => n.toLowerCase());
|
||||
const enabledNames = new Set(
|
||||
this.plugin.settings.calendarUrls
|
||||
.filter((s) => s.enabled)
|
||||
.map((s) => s.name.toLowerCase())
|
||||
);
|
||||
filteredEvents = filteredEvents.filter((event) => {
|
||||
const lowered = event.source.toLowerCase();
|
||||
return lowerNames.includes(lowered) && enabledNames.has(lowered);
|
||||
});
|
||||
}
|
||||
```
|
||||
|
||||
Apply the same fix to `getAllEventsForEmbed` (lines 168-189).

### CR-02: `isValidCache` accepts malformed event payloads, leading to silent event loss
|
||||
|
||||
**File:** `src/services/CalendarService.ts:317-324`, `src/services/CalendarService.ts:326-334`
|
||||
|
||||
**Issue:** The cache validator only verifies `timestamp: number` and `events: Array`. After Plan 02 migrated the cast to `cache: unknown` (good), the inner shape of `cache.events` is still untrusted:
|
||||
|
||||
```ts
|
||||
private isValidCache(cache: unknown): cache is CacheData {
|
||||
if (!cache || typeof cache !== "object") return false;
|
||||
const c = cache as Record<string, unknown>;
|
||||
return (
|
||||
typeof c.timestamp === "number" &&
|
||||
Array.isArray(c.events)
|
||||
);
|
||||
}
|
||||
```
|
||||
|
||||
`restoreFromCache` then iterates blindly:
|
||||
|
||||
```ts
|
||||
cache.events.forEach((event) => {
|
||||
event.start = new Date(event.start); // new Date("garbage") => Invalid Date
|
||||
event.end = new Date(event.end);
|
||||
});
|
||||
this.events = cache.events;
|
||||
```
|
||||
|
||||
A corrupted, partially-written, or downgrade-incompatible `calendar-cache.json` (the cache file lives under `.obsidian/plugins/memochron/calendar-cache.json` and survives plugin updates) yields `Invalid Date` values for `start`/`end`. Every downstream date comparison (`event.start <= endOfDay`, `event.end >= startOfDay`, `event.end < now`) silently evaluates `false` because `NaN` comparisons return `false`. Result: the user sees zero events, no error notice, no console message (the catch on line 302 is `DEBUG`-gated and `DEBUG = false` in production). The user has no path to recover except to delete the cache file manually.
|
||||
|
||||
This is a data-loss-shaped bug (loss of visibility, not corruption) made worse by Plan 03's console cleanup, because the cache-decode failure path went from `console.log(...)` to `if (DEBUG) console.debug(...)` — there is now NO production diagnostic when the cache deserializes badly.
|
||||
|
||||
**Fix:** Validate per-event shape and reject the cache instead of silently using bad data:
|
||||
|
||||
```ts
|
||||
private isValidCache(cache: unknown): cache is CacheData {
|
||||
if (!cache || typeof cache !== "object") return false;
|
||||
const c = cache as Record<string, unknown>;
|
||||
if (typeof c.timestamp !== "number") return false;
|
||||
if (!Array.isArray(c.events)) return false;
|
||||
return c.events.every((e) => {
|
||||
if (!e || typeof e !== "object") return false;
|
||||
const ev = e as Record<string, unknown>;
|
||||
return (
|
||||
typeof ev.id === "string" &&
|
||||
typeof ev.title === "string" &&
|
||||
typeof ev.source === "string" &&
|
||||
typeof ev.sourceId === "string" &&
|
||||
(typeof ev.start === "string" || ev.start instanceof Date) &&
|
||||
(typeof ev.end === "string" || ev.end instanceof Date) &&
|
||||
!isNaN(new Date(ev.start as string | Date).getTime()) &&
|
||||
!isNaN(new Date(ev.end as string | Date).getTime())
|
||||
);
|
||||
});
|
||||
}
|
||||
```
|
||||
|
||||
Additionally, the `catch (error)` on CalendarService.ts:301-302 should at minimum log unconditionally (not `DEBUG`-gated) when the cache file exists but fails to deserialize — silent recovery is fine for "no cache file" but not for "cache file is broken."

### WR-02: DIR-01 console cleanup silently swallows non-403/404 calendar fetch errors
|
||||
|
||||
**File:** `src/services/CalendarService.ts:386-392`, `src/services/CalendarService.ts:402-415`
|
||||
|
||||
**Issue:** Plan 03's `if (DEBUG) console.error(...)` gating means that in production builds (`DEBUG = false`), the following error paths produce ZERO user-visible or developer-visible output:
|
||||
|
||||
1. Line 387-391 (`else` branch for non-403/404 HTTP failure): the body is `if (DEBUG) console.error(...)`. A 500, 502, 503, 401, 429, etc., now produces neither a Notice nor a console line. The user sees their calendar silently fail to refresh.
|
||||
2. Line 405: `if (DEBUG) console.error('Error fetching calendar ...', message);` — runs only when DEBUG is true. The function then checks `message.includes('CORS')` and `message.includes('network')` to show specific Notices, but EVERY other thrown error (e.g., "ERR_CERT_AUTHORITY_INVALID", "ETIMEDOUT", "ENOTFOUND") produces no Notice and no console output.
|
||||
|
||||
The Phase-3 SUMMARY notes 33 console statements were deleted and 6 gated — but these two were gated, not surfaced as Notices. The result is a regression from "noisy logs the user can grep for" to "completely silent failure."
|
||||
|
||||
**Fix:** Add a generic fallback Notice for unmatched error categories, and unconditionally log the error so developers diagnosing user reports can ask the user to check the dev console:
|
||||
|
||||
```ts
|
||||
// fetchCalendar catch block
|
||||
} catch (error) {
|
||||
const message = errorMessage(error);
|
||||
console.error(`MemoChron: Failed to fetch calendar "${source.name}":`, message);
|
||||
|
||||
if (message.includes('CORS')) {
|
||||
new Notice(`MemoChron: Calendar "${source.name}" blocked by CORS policy.`);
|
||||
} else if (message.includes('network')) {
|
||||
new Notice(`MemoChron: Network error fetching calendar "${source.name}".`);
|
||||
} else {
|
||||
new Notice(`MemoChron: Failed to fetch calendar "${source.name}". Check console for details.`);
|
||||
}
|
||||
return [];
|
||||
}
|
||||
```
|
||||
|
||||
Apply equivalent treatment to the non-403/404 status branch on line 387-391. The DIR-01 rule prohibits *unconditional* console statements, but error paths should still surface to the user — the appropriate fix is a Notice, not a DEBUG-gated console call.

### WR-03: `fetchInFlight` deduplication ignores source-set changes mid-fetch
|
||||
|
||||
**File:** `src/services/CalendarService.ts:55-87`
|
||||
|
||||
**Issue:** The in-flight short-circuit (BUG-06/D-12) runs BEFORE the source-mismatch check:
|
||||
|
||||
```ts
|
||||
if (this.fetchInFlight) {
|
||||
return this.fetchInFlight;
|
||||
}
|
||||
// ...
|
||||
if (!this.needsRefresh(enabledSources, forceRefresh)) {
|
||||
return this.events;
|
||||
}
|
||||
```
|
||||
|
||||
If caller A starts a fetch with sources `[X, Y]`, and while it's running the user adds calendar `Z` in settings (triggering `saveSettings → refreshCalendarView → fetchCalendars(newSources)`), caller B with sources `[X, Y, Z]` receives caller A's in-flight promise — which only fetches `[X, Y]`. The mismatch will be detected on the NEXT `fetchCalendars` call (via `hasSourceMismatch`), but the user-triggered refresh appears to "do nothing" — the Notice shows complete with the OLD event count.
|
||||
|
||||
Worse, the `Notice` on completion (`showCompletionNotification`) reports `this.events.length` — which is the count from caller A's fetch, not caller B's expected fetch. If the user added a calendar with 100 events, the Notice still shows the old count.
|
||||
|
||||
**Fix:** Detect the source-set change and chain a follow-up fetch after the in-flight one settles, or invalidate the in-flight cache for `forceRefresh=true`:
|
||||
|
||||
```ts
|
||||
async fetchCalendars(
|
||||
sources: CalendarSource[],
|
||||
forceRefresh = false
|
||||
): Promise<CalendarEvent[]> {
|
||||
// If the caller forces a refresh OR the source set differs from what's in flight,
|
||||
// do not dedupe — start a fresh fetch chained after the in-flight one settles.
|
||||
if (this.fetchInFlight && !forceRefresh && !this.hasSourceMismatch(
|
||||
sources.filter((s) => s.enabled && s.url?.trim())
|
||||
)) {
|
||||
return this.fetchInFlight;
|
||||
}
|
||||
// ... rest as before
|
||||
}
|
||||
```

### WR-07: External link in help modal lacks `rel="noopener"`
|
||||
|
||||
**File:** `src/settings/SettingsTab.ts:1934-1938`
|
||||
|
||||
**Issue:**
|
||||
```ts
|
||||
const link = docLink.createEl("a", {
|
||||
text: "View full documentation on GitHub",
|
||||
href: "https://github.com/formax68/memoChron#remote-calendars",
|
||||
});
|
||||
link.setAttr("target", "_blank");
|
||||
```
|
||||
|
||||
`target="_blank"` without `rel="noopener noreferrer"` allows the opened tab to navigate the opener via `window.opener.location` (reverse-tabnabbing). In Electron with `nodeIntegration` disabled this is partially mitigated, but Obsidian renders external links via the system browser and the rendered HTML still sets `window.opener`. Best practice is to set `rel`.
|
||||
|
||||
**Fix:**
|
||||
|
||||
```ts
|
||||
link.setAttr("target", "_blank");
|
||||
link.setAttr("rel", "noopener noreferrer");
|
||||
```

### IN-02: Per-file `const DEBUG = false` declarations are out of sync risk
|
||||
|
||||
**File:** `src/services/CalendarService.ts:17`, `src/utils/timezoneUtils.ts:7`
|
||||
|
||||
**Issue:** Plan 03 introduced `const DEBUG = false` independently in two files. The same flag controls different diagnostic outputs in different modules. A developer debugging a calendar issue who flips `CalendarService.ts:17` to `true` will get fetch/cache logs but no timezone logs unless they also remember to flip `timezoneUtils.ts:7`. Conversely, leaving one accidentally at `true` ships verbose logs in a release build.
|
||||
|
||||
**Fix:** Centralize into `src/utils/debug.ts`:
|
||||
|
||||
```ts
|
||||
// Single source of truth for forensic-only logging.
|
||||
// Production builds: flag must be `false`. esbuild tree-shakes `if (DEBUG) ...`.
|
||||
export const DEBUG = false;
|
||||
```
|
||||
|
||||
Then import in both consumers. The build-time elimination still works because the import resolves to a module-level `const` initializer.

### IN-03: `viewRenderers.getReorderedWeekdays` silently breaks on out-of-range `firstDayOfWeek`
|
||||
|
||||
**File:** `src/utils/viewRenderers.ts:226-229`
|
||||
|
||||
**Issue:**
|
||||
|
||||
```ts
|
||||
function getReorderedWeekdays(firstDay: number): string[] {
|
||||
const weekdays = ["Su", "Mo", "Tu", "We", "Th", "Fr", "Sa"];
|
||||
return [...weekdays.slice(firstDay), ...weekdays.slice(0, firstDay)];
|
||||
}
|
||||
```
|
||||
|
||||
If `firstDay` is `7` (or any out-of-range value), `slice(7)` returns `[]` and `slice(0, 7)` returns the full array — so the function happens to round-trip and produce a valid week. But if `firstDay = -1` or `firstDay = NaN`, `slice` semantics differ and the rendered weekdays misalign with the day grid. The settings dropdown clamps to 0-6 (`SettingsTab.ts:101-109`), so today there is no path to a bad value — but settings restored from a corrupted `data.json` (the same threat model as SEC-01's color validation in `main.ts:110-121`) could inject a bad number.
|
||||
|
||||
**Fix:** Clamp at the function boundary:
|
||||
|
||||
```ts
|
||||
function getReorderedWeekdays(firstDay: number): string[] {
|
||||
const fd = Math.max(0, Math.min(6, Math.floor(firstDay) || 0));
|
||||
const weekdays = ["Su", "Mo", "Tu", "We", "Th", "Fr", "Sa"];
|
||||
return [...weekdays.slice(fd), ...weekdays.slice(0, fd)];
|
||||
}
|
||||
```
|
||||
|
||||
Apply the same clamp to `CalendarView.getReorderedWeekdays` (line 508-512) and `getMonthInfo`/`getStartOfWeek` (they all consume `firstDayOfWeek`).

### IN-07: `CalendarView.checkDailyNoteForDate` swallows non-existent-plugin errors
|
||||
|
||||
**File:** `src/views/CalendarView.ts:153-167`
|
||||
|
||||
**Issue:**
|
||||
|
||||
```ts
|
||||
private checkDailyNoteForDate(date: Date): boolean {
|
||||
if (!appHasDailyNotesPluginLoaded()) return false;
|
||||
try {
|
||||
const momentDate = moment(date);
|
||||
const allDailyNotes = getAllDailyNotes();
|
||||
const dailyNote = getDailyNote(momentDate, allDailyNotes);
|
||||
return dailyNote !== null;
|
||||
} catch {
|
||||
return false;
|
||||
}
|
||||
}
|
||||
```
|
||||
|
||||
If `getAllDailyNotes()` throws (e.g., due to a malformed Daily Notes plugin config that leaves a TFile that's actually a folder, or an invalid moment format string), every grid cell silently reports "no daily note exists" and the indicator dot disappears. The user sees a calendar that LOOKS correct but has lost data. The DIR-01 cleanup turned what was probably a `console.warn` into a silent catch.
|
||||
|
||||
This is called once per visible day per render (e.g., 35-42 times per renderCalendar). Throwing once per call is fine, but unconditionally returning `false` hides legitimate state.
|
||||
|
||||
**Fix:** Cache the all-daily-notes lookup at render start and log once:
|
||||
|
||||
```ts
|
||||
private dailyNotesCache: Record<string, TFile> | null = null;
|
||||
|
||||
private refreshDailyNotesCache(): void {
|
||||
if (!appHasDailyNotesPluginLoaded()) {
|
||||
this.dailyNotesCache = null;
|
||||
return;
|
||||
}
|
||||
try {
|
||||
this.dailyNotesCache = getAllDailyNotes() as Record<string, TFile>;
|
||||
} catch (error) {
|
||||
console.error("MemoChron: Failed to load daily notes:", errorMessage(error));
|
||||
this.dailyNotesCache = null;
|
||||
}
|
||||
}
|
||||
|
||||
private checkDailyNoteForDate(date: Date): boolean {
|
||||
if (!this.dailyNotesCache) return false;
|
||||
try {
|
||||
const momentDate = moment(date);
|
||||
return getDailyNote(momentDate, this.dailyNotesCache) !== null;
|
||||
} catch {
|
||||
return false;
|
||||
}
|
||||
}
|
||||
```
|
||||
|
||||
Call `refreshDailyNotesCache()` at the start of `renderCalendar()`. This both improves performance (one `getAllDailyNotes()` per render instead of one per day cell) AND surfaces the error path once.
